We like to think of our “home sweet home” as our haven of safety and security. However, home accidents are responsible for more fatal injuries than any other cause except motor vehicle accidents. Although home accidents are often caused by human error and typically can be prevented, they amount to 18,000 deaths and nearly 13 million injuries a year.
The five leading causes of deaths that happen around the home are due to falls, poisonings, fires, suffocation and choking and drowning. In the above video I give some important and critical tips to Natalie Morales on the Today Show. A few simple precautions can save you and/or your child’s life!

A replacement window is only as good as its installation – have it done wrong and your old, leaky, drafty windows will be transformed into new, leaky, drafty windows. Where's the savings in that? The replacement window industry is huge, and it's filled with a lot of fly-by-night dealers,you’ll see on late night TV. With all kinds of bells and whistles that may or may not be that important. It can be difficult to figure out a good window just by looking at it in a showroom. You can avoid buying cheap windows and shoddy installation by buying from major national brands, or good regional brands with a solid track record.
